<p><a href="http://www.best-audiobooks.com/title.aspx?titleId=13128">Dorian Gray</a>,  a handsome and narcissistic young man, lives thoughtlessly for his own  pleasure—an attitude encouraged by the company he keeps. One day, after  having his portrait painted, Dorian  makes a frivolous Faustian wish: that he should always remain as young  and beautiful as he is in that painting, while the portrait grows old in  his stead.</p>
<p>The wish comes true, and Dorian  soon finds that none of his wicked actions have visible consequences.  Realizing that he will appear fresh and unspoiled no matter what kind of  life he lives, Dorian becomes increasingly corrupt, unchecked by public opinion. Only the portrait grows degenerate and ugly, a powerful symbol of Dorian’s internal ruin.</p>
<p>Wilde’s  dreamlike exploration of life without limits scandalized its  late-Victorian audience and has haunted readers’ imaginations for more  than a hundred years.</p>

Lycett  has also succeeded in separating the author from the phenomenon while  putting both in the context of their times.”—<em>Library Journal</em> Sportsman, womanizer, naval commander, world traveler, and spy, the  creator of the Cold War’s archetypal secret agent was infinitely more  complex and interesting than his iconic fictional character, Agent 007.  Fleming’s wide ranging and exciting life inevitably provided the  plausible backdrop for his Bond novels. Highly regarded in British naval  intelligence for his international contacts, he masterminded numerous  top secret operations, including “Golden Eye,” which is uncovered here  for the first time. He was also fundamental in shaping the prototype  CIA. Two months before his wedding to Ann O&#8217;Neill, the widow of a friend  with whom he’d carried on a passionate affair for fifteen years,  Fleming sat down to write his first book, <em>Casino Royale</em>, in order to soothe his nerves. Thus began the long line of Bond novels for which he would earn lasting fame.</p>
<p><strong>Andrew Lycett</strong> received a history degree from Oxford University before becoming a journalist at the <em>Sunday Times</em> (London), where he served as a foreign correspondent in Africa and the  Middle East. He has written acclaimed biographies on Ian Fleming, Dylan  Thomas, Sir Arthur Conan-Doyle, Muammar al-Gaddafi, and Rudyard Kipling.  He lives in London.</p>

<p>Joyce’s experimental masterpiece set a new standard for modernist  fiction, pushing the English language past all previous thresholds in  its quest to capture a day in the life of an Everyman in  turn-of-the-century Dublin. Obliquely borrowing characters and  situations from Homer’s <em>Odyssey</em>, Joyce takes us on an internal  odyssey along the current of thoughts, impressions, and experiences that  make up the adventure of living an average day. As his characters  stroll, eat, ruminate, and argue through the streets of Dublin, Joyce’s  stream-of-consciousness narrative artfully weaves events, emotions, and  memories in a free flow of imagery and associations. Full of literary  references, parody, and uncensored vulgarity, <em>Ulysses</em> has been considered controversial and challenging, but always brilliant and rewarding.   <strong>James Joyce</strong> (1882–1941) was an Irish expatriate writer,  widely considered to be one of the most influential writers of the  twentieth century. He is best known for his landmark novel <em>Ulysses</em> and its highly controversial successor <em>Finnegans Wake</em>, as well as the short-story collection <em>Dubliners</em> and the semi-autobiographical novel <em>A Portrait of the Artist as a Young </em><em>Man</em>.</p>

<p>Remember Perry Mason, the attorney who always got a conviction, played by Raymond Burr.  The black and white television series ran from 1957 until 1966 and covered 270 episodes.  They were based on the who dunnit books written by Erle Stanley Gardner. The television production usually started with the scene of a murder, and generally finished with a court scene where Perry Mason would inevitably get a conviction and the episode would end with a smart or humourous remark from Perry. And we must not forget Perry&#8217;s able assistant Della Street played by Barbara Hale.<br />

<p>The most influential writer in all of English literature, William Shakespeare was born in 1564 to a -successful middle-class glove-maker in Stratford-upon-Avon, England. Shakespeare attended grammar school, but his formal education proceeded no further. In 1582 he married an older woman, Anne Hathaway, and had three children with her. Around 1590 he left his family behind and traveled to London to work as an actor and playwright. Public and critical success quickly followed, and Shakespeare eventually became the most popular playwright in England and part-owner of the Globe Theate.<br />

<p>According to legend, <span class="SEARCH_HIGHLIGHT">Sweeney</span> Todd had his barber shop at number 186 Fleet Street, next door to St. Dunstan&#8217;s Church, just a few blocks away from the Royal Courts of Justice. On this site, they say, he robbed and murdered more than 150 customers. To dispose of their remains, he carried them through underground tunnels to the bakery of one Mrs. Lovett a few blocks away, where they supplied the stuffing for her meat pies, the favorite mid-day repast of the lawyers who worked nearby and got their shaves from <span class="SEARCH_HIGHLIGHT">Sweeney</span> Todd. The man you lunched with yesterday could be your lunch today! The story first appeared in 1846 as a best-selling &#8220;penny dreadful,&#8221; a sensational thriller published in installments. Before the final chapters even had a chance to hit the stands, the first stage version was packing them in at the Royal Britannia Saloon.
